How they compare
Argentina currently reports -1.7% against -2.2% in Timor-Leste, a difference of 0.5%.
The two have swapped places 11 times across 34 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Timor-Leste ahead.
Argentina ranks 201st and Timor-Leste ranks 204th of 212 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Argentina averaged higher in 2 and Timor-Leste in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Argentina | Timor-Leste |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 4.7% | 2.2% | 2.5% | Argentina |
| 2000s | 2.6% | 9.7% | 7.1% | Timor-Leste |
| 2010s | 1.4% | 5.3% | 4.0% | Timor-Leste |
| 2020s | 0.5% | -0.7% | 1.2% | Argentina |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
